Please have the following information ready when you call the Help Desk:
:Model number
:Serial number
:Version number (if available)
:Date of failure or problem
:Symptoms of failure or problem
:Customer return address and contact information
If repair is required, you will be given a Returned Material Authorization (RMA) Number. This number must appear on the outside of the package and on the Bill Of Lading (if applicable). Use the original packaging or request packaging from the Help Desk or distributor. Units damaged in shipment as a result of improper packaging are not covered under warranty. A replacement or repair unit will be shipped, freight prepaid for all warrantied units.
NOTE For any warranty claim to be valid, the Warranty Registration Card must be on file, or Proof and Date of Purchase must be returned with the failed unit.
For critical applications, immediate replacement may be available. Call the Help Desk for the dealer or distributor nearest you.
